Hi all, C4/5 complete here. I've been using a Kensington trackball for years without much of an issue. However, a recent fracture to my arm arm has temporarily (hopefully only temporarily) impacted my ability to use the trackball. With that, and as I age and likely become weaker, I'm wondering if it may be beneficial to look into other forms of mouse. In a quick search, I've come across the Quad Stick and Quad Joy. What are the differences? I'm simply interested in computer use only, with the ability to use with a MAC or PC. I'm not interested in gaming. I'd like a set up that I can drive up to, and not rely on set up from others to use daily. Any feedback is appreciated.

Both require you to put your mouth around the control, which can accumulate spit and require frequent cleaning and/or changing out disposable parts. Have you also considered the Headmouse? https://www.orin.com/access/headmouse/
